extrasensory

ek struh sen suh ree

  • a  seemingly outside normal sensory channels

  • A few minutes after the sighting, Barney Hill turned the car down a side road, impelled by some extrasensory command.
  • But today it also extends all the way from Satanism and witchcraft to the edges of science, as in Astronaut Edgar Mitchell's experiment in extrasensory perception from aboard .
  • I believe that I have experienced extrasensory perception.
